Heads up, reviewer: we've tightened the defaults for sandboxing user-supplied formulas. Previously the Formulator engine evaluated custom expressions with a generous 10-second timeout and full access to the shared scratch store, which, surprise, people abused. New defaults cap execution time, cut memory per evaluation, and drop scratch-store access unless the sheet owner opts in. Existing workbooks get a one-release grace period via a compat flag. Nothing else in the eval path changed. The new sandbox defaults are as follows.

settings of fawip-yadug:
[druath]
port = 3000
region = north-4
host = druath.qirvanworks.corp
timeout_ms = 1500
retries = 1

# Export limits — Tallygrove spreadsheets

XLSX export streams rows but buffers styles and merged-cell maps in memory, so wide sheets dominate footprint, not row count. Exports exceeding the soft cap are queued to the low-priority worker pool; the hard cap aborts with a partial-file error. Do not raise caps for a single tenant. Current limits are the constants below.

tuning table, kajog-bawip:
TIERS = {
    "kelius": 256,
    "lammir": 543,
}

Handover — Ostley Warehouse Lease

Hi all — passing this to Director Brann as I rotate off. We're mid-renegotiation with Pellgrave Estates on the Ostley site. They opened at a 12% uplift; we countered at 4% plus a longer break clause. Tomas has the draft terms and the comparables from the Harwick district. Keep finance looped in on any movement. Context on why this site matters is noted below.

confidential, kagep-kahof: Druokax Systems plans to lower the Ulaath list price by 53 percent in March.